rip --auto-ripenv and rip-find-package

In a multi-ripenv workflow I've found it handy to have package-centered commands work automatically regardless of the current ripenv. This option does that by finding the package's correct ripenv and setting it. I realize --ripenv exists but this is less typing and would make it easier to use rip's packages in a simpler, global manner.

Examples of commands that would benefit from this:

$ rip -a uninstall ronn
$ rip -a info ronn
$ rip -a readme ronn

# Plugins
$ rip -a open ronn
# From http://github.com/cldwalker/rip-licious
$ rip -a test ronn
$ rip -a git log ronn

Notice I've also added rip-find-package which completes the TODO in rip-uninstall. I can refactor that part and add tests as needed.
